Webb28 juli 2024 · The most important advantage of learning a language is its ability to ward off diseases such as Alzheimer’s and Dementia. The results of various studies showed that in adults who speak two or more languages, the first signs of the diseases were offset by a few years! While it may not be a cure, it certainly buys you some time. 9.

WebbLearning two languages at once is certainly possible. That said, it’s not a mission I’d recommend taking on lightly. So, if you’re serious about reaching fluency in two target languages rather than just studying them for the fun of it, I recommend you don’t study them both at the same time.
